  • With the impending cancellation of the Chinese GP, Portuguese media are reporting that Portimao Circuit is set to be added as replacement. The Portimao circuit was used for the covid affected 2020 and 2021 seasons. The track is an old-school type track with sweeping corners and an undulating track.     Ferrari Team Principle, Matia Binotto has resigned and will leave Marinello at the en of the year. Ferrari have confirmed that Matia Binotto has resigned from the team but will remain in his position until December 31st. The team also confirmed that they hope to confirm a new Team Principle in the new year. Ferrari…
